1. Continuous Harvesting

One of the most significant benefits of growing Tristar plants is the extended period of harvest they offer. Unlike traditional strawberry varieties that produce fruit for a short period, Tristar plants produce berries continuously throughout the growing season. This means that you can enjoy fresh strawberries from your garden for an extended period, making it an excellent choice for those who enjoy having fresh fruit readily available.

3. Compact Size

Another advantage of Tristar plants is their compact size. Unlike some strawberry varieties that spread and take up a lot of space in the garden, Tristar plants are relatively small and neat. This makes them an excellent choice for those with limited gardening space, such as balconies, patios, or small urban gardens. Their compact size also makes them easier to care for and maintain.

4. Disease Resistance

Disease resistance is a crucial factor to consider when selecting plants for your garden. Fortunately, Tristar plants exhibit resistance to common strawberry diseases such as powdery mildew and leaf spot. This means that you can enjoy a healthy and thriving strawberry crop without the constant worry of diseases affecting your plants. By choosing disease-resistant plants like Tristar, you can minimize the need for chemical treatments and ensure a more sustainable garden.

6. Versatility

Tristar plants are not limited to traditional garden beds. They can be grown in various settings, including containers, hanging baskets, or even as ground cover. This versatility makes them an excellent choice for any garden style or size. Whether you have a small balcony or a large backyard, you can easily incorporate Tristar plants into your garden design.

7. Low Maintenance

Gardening should be enjoyable and not overly demanding in terms of maintenance. Tristar plants require minimal care, making them an ideal choice for gardeners who want to enjoy fresh strawberries without spending hours tending to their plants. With proper watering, occasional fertilization, and regular removal of runners (the shoots that strawberries produce), you can ensure healthy and productive Tristar plants with minimal effort.
